Quando um programador 1C fica entediado

Versão básica do investidor do especulador de ações.



Quando um programador 1C fica entediado, ele tenta alegrar seu tempo livre da melhor maneira possível. E ele só sabe programar. Ao mesmo tempo, o programador muitas vezes não possui as habilidades para trabalhar com instrumentos de intercâmbio. É assim que o programa nasce. Então ela fica mais inteligente. Então, não requer mais a participação de um programador.



imagem



O programa é executado na plataforma 1C Enterprise 8. Foi testado no modo de versão de arquivo na plataforma Windows 10. O desempenho do programa também é possível na arquitetura 1C Enterprise 8 de três camadas em ambientes do tipo Windows. Isso se deve aos mecanismos usados ​​no programa.



1. Fontes de dados (troca de informações do sistema)



O Quik 8.7 Exchange Terminal é usado como uma fonte de dados.



Para troca, o banco de dados Microsoft Access é usado como fonte de informação.Para



imagem



carregar tarefas no sistema, um mecanismo de troca é usado que usa arquivos de troca.



imagem



2. Área de trabalho do programa



Como esperado, o programa deve ter uma área de trabalho que reflita imediatamente o estado atual das coisas.



imagem



A saber: trata-se da informação de câmbio atual que chega em tempo real e, claro, a situação atual da carteira de instrumentos de câmbio disponíveis. Claro, é melhor refletir a carteira em pelo menos três ângulos: pela estratégia, pelo setor do instrumento, pela classificação adicional do instrumento em relação à situação cambial.



3. Os bastidores do programa



Na área de trabalho, é claro, você pode ir diretamente para a seção desejada, mas é claro que você precisa ser capaz de ver os bastidores do programa.



imagem



Tudo aqui é baseado em mecanismos típicos disponíveis na plataforma 1C Enterprise.



4. O diretório "Instrumentos de câmbio" passará a ser um local de armazenamento de informações sobre cada instrumento de troca.



imagem



imagem



5. O documento "Quik import data" ajudará a receber dados sobre a situação na troca de um sistema externo.



imagem



6. O documento “Cessão para compra de ferramentas” ajudará a transferir as informações do que queremos comprar para o sistema externo.



imagem



7. O documento “Cessão para venda de instrumentos” nos ajudará a transferir informações sobre o que queremos vender para o sistema externo.



imagem



8. As informações retornarão do sistema externo na forma de documentos "Compra de instrumentos" e "Venda de instrumentos".



imagem



9. Para ver o resultado do que compramos, precisaremos de um relatório "Disponibilidade de instrumentos"



imagem



10. Para ver o que vendemos, precisaremos de um relatório "Vendas de instrumentos"



imagem



11. Vamos tentar tornar o programa mais inteligente.



Vamos adicionar a capacidade de armazenar o histórico de dados recebidos de um sistema externo por preço.



imagem



E para outros parâmetros.



imagem



imagem



12. Vamos tentar analisar e prever dados com base na busca no sistema por combinações semelhantes de comportamento. Precisamos de uma ferramenta que, com base na situação atual de um instrumento no mercado, selecione situações semelhantes para outros instrumentos e nos permita prever o preço.



imagem



13. Não é preciso dizer que não devemos nos esquecer dos mecanismos de análise e previsão embutidos na plataforma.



imagem



imagem



imagem



imagem



14. Como o Terminal de Negociação já possui um rico mecanismo de análise gráfica, não adianta repeti-lo. Só um pouquinho.



imagem



15. Resta adicionar configurações / constantes. E inicie o programa por conta própria.



imagem



imagem



imagem



imagem



Eu nem esperava que surgisse um sistema de autoaprendizagem, que algum dia pode render dinheiro com a bolsa. Resta esperar o crescimento do mercado e sorte.



All Articles